What is Bosko's Parlor Pranks (1934) about?

In this lively animated short, Bosko keeps his friend Wilbur entertained with exaggerated stories of his past adventures while Honey steps out to run an errand. The film blends humor and charm, showcasing the playful spirit of early animation.

Who directed Bosko's Parlor Pranks?

The film was directed by Hugh Harman, a pioneer in animation whose work helped shape the medium during its formative years.

About Bosko's Parlor Pranks (1934) — A Classic Animation Short from the Golden Age

Dive into the playful world of Bosko's Parlor Pranks (1934), a classic animated short directed by the visionary Hugh Harman. This eight-minute comedy-thriller follows the mischievous Bosko as he keeps his pal Wilbur entertained with exaggerated tales of his past antics, while Honey steps out for a quick errand. Set against the backdrop of early animation, the film blends slapstick humor with the charm of 1930s cartoon aesthetics, offering a nostalgic peek into the golden age of shorts. The playful atmosphere crackles with witty dialogue and expressive visuals, capturing the spirit of innocence and creativity that defined Harman's work during this era.
